Adrian Clarke (Canadian football)

Adrian Clarke (born July 9, 1991) is a professional Canadian football linebacker who is a free agent.

[1] He played college football for the Bishop's Gaiters from 2011 to 2014 at the linebacker and safety positions, recording 101 solo tackles and seven sacks over 34 games.

[3] Clarke recorded the fastest 40-yard dash time at the CFL Combine among the linebackers who participated.

[4] After making the active roster to start the 2015 season, Clarke made his CFL debut in the Lions' first game of the season against the Ottawa Redblacks, where he completed two special teams tackles.

[5] He spent the 2018 season with the Saskatchewan Roughriders and did not play professionally in 2019.
